Abstract
The invention discloses an acaricidal composition containing active ingredients, namely chlorine chlorfenapyr and spirodiclofen. The weight ratio of the chlorine chlorfenapyr to the spirodiclofen is (1-30) to (1-30), and the total weight of the active ingredients accounts for 1%-60% of that of the composition. The acaricidal composition provided by the invention is prepared into wettable powder, water dispersible granules, suspending agent, suspoemulsion and microcapsule suspension according to a universal technology in the field. The acaricidal composition is used for preventing red spiders, polyphagotarsonemus latus, tetranychus cinabarinus boisdu and tetranychus urticae koch, and further can be used for preventing mites on fruit trees, vegetables and cotton. The acaricidal composition has the advantages that firstly, the synergism is remarkable, wherein the chlorine chlorfenapyr and the spirodiclofen are blended with each other without conflict, so that the synergism can be adjusted, the dosage of the composition can be reduced, and the cost can be reduced; secondly, by virtue of double action mechanisms of the compounded two acaricide, the insecticide resistance of the mites is delayed; and thirdly, an insecticidal spectrum is expanded, wherein the application range of the composition is enlarged, and the composition is suitable for a plurality of mites on the fruit trees, the vegetables and the cotton.

Background technology
The chlorine chlorfenapyr, chemical name is 4-bromo-2-(4-chlorphenyl)-1-[(2-chloroethoxy) methyl]-5-trifluoromethyl pyrpole-3-formonitrile HCN, be the new pyrrole heterocycle compound with obvious pesticide and miticide actility that Hunan Chemical Research Institute designs and synthesizes.
Its structural formula is:
The chlorine chlorfenapyr is the analog of new type disinsection miticide chlorfenapyr.Thereby its mechanism of action is by disturbing Intramitochondrial electrochemical gradient blocking oxide phosphorylation process.Through result of the test show noval chemical compound chlorine chlorfenapyr have excellent tag, stomach poison activity and comprehensive toxic action, its toxicity is low, safety is good, without cross resistance.
Spiral shell mite ester (Spirodiclofen) chemical name be 3-(2,4-dichlorophenyl)-2-oxo-1-oxaspiro [4,5]-last of the ten Heavenly stems-3-alkene-4-base-2,2-dimethyl butyrate acid esters.Its structural formula is for being:
The mechanism of action is the Fatty synthesis that suppresses in the pest mite body.Spiral shell mite ester has tags and stomach toxicity, without interior absorption.It is wide that it kills mite spectrum, the ovum children holds concurrently and kills, lasting period length, low toxicity, low-residual, safety are good, and other miticides without cross resistance.Shortcoming is that its quick-acting is poor, to becoming the mite effect undesirable.Use with existing miticide, both can improve its quick-acting, be conducive to again the resistance management of mite evil.
Have not yet to see about the composite relevant report of chlorine chlorfenapyr and spiral shell mite ester.

The processing method of this miticide composition microcapsule suspending agent has two kinds:
Method one: the preparation of (1) urea resin prepolymer: with urea and the 37% formalin (mix and blend of mol ratio=1:1.5-2), regulate pH to 8.5 with triethylamine, be warming up to 70 ℃, with 450 rev/mins of stirring reactions 1 hour, obtain the urea resin prepolymer aqueous solution; (2) micro-capsule suspension preparation: under the normal temperature, chlorine chlorfenapyr, spiral shell mite ester are dissolved in the solvent, add dispersant, urea-formaldehyde resin aqueous solution, emulsifier under the stirring condition, high speed homogenizing 5 minutes, form and reduce rotating speed to 450 rev/min after the oil-in-water emulsion, regulate pH, reaction is 1 hour under acid catalysis, to reaction end, transfer pH to neutral; Add adjuvant, thickener, stir and namely make microcapsule suspending agent.
Method two: (1) is dissolved in chlorine chlorfenapyr, spiral shell mite ester in the solvent, and adding capsule leather material stirs and obtains oil phase; (2) in water, add emulsifier, adjuvant stirs and obtains water; (3) water joins in the oil phase, and the high speed homogenizing forms the stabilized oil-in-water emulsion; (4) under 450 rev/mins, add polyamine and participate in interface polymerization reaction, reaction temperature rises to 25 ℃-70 ℃, keeps solidifying in 2-24 hour encystation; (5) add dispersant, thickener, stir and namely make microcapsule suspending agent.

This experiment is the method that adopts Toxicity Determination and field trial to combine.First by Toxicity Determination, the co-toxicity coefficient (CTC) after clear and definite two kinds of medicaments are composite by a certain percentage, CTC<80 are antagonism, and 80≤CTC≤120 are summation action, and CTC 〉=120 are synergistic effect, on this basis, carry out field trial again.
Table 1. spiral shell mite ester, chlorine chlorfenapyr are to the Toxicity Determination of two-spotted spider mite
As shown in Table 1, spiral shell mite ester and chlorine chlorfenapyr are respectively 2.09mg/L and 2.63mg/L to the LC50 of two spotted spider mite.Spiral shell mite ester and chlorine chlorfenapyr proportioning are when 30:1 to 1:30, and co-toxicity coefficient CTC is all greater than 120, illustrate that spiral shell mite ester and chlorine chlorfenapyr are mixed all to show synergistic effect in 30:1 to 1:30 scope, and especially both synergistic effects when 10:1 are the most obvious.
The test of pesticide effectiveness of table 2 spiral shell mite ester, chlorine chlorfenapyr and composite control two spotted spider mite thereof
As can be seen from Table 2, can effectively prevent and treat two spotted spider mite after spiral shell mite ester and chlorine chlorfenapyr are composite, control efficiency all is better than the preventive effect of single dose.In the test scope of medication, the target crop is had no adverse effects.
The test of pesticide effectiveness of table 3 spiral shell mite ester, chlorine chlorfenapyr and composite control oranges and tangerines Tetranychus urticae thereof
As can be seen from Table 3, not only two spotted spider mite is had good preventive effect after spiral shell mite ester and chlorine chlorfenapyr are composite, the oranges and tangerines Tetranychus urticae is also had significant preventive effect, control efficiency is better than the preventive effect of single dose, and has enlarged insecticidal spectrum.
